What Makes lokio Different?

lokio isn't just another CLI tool - it's your intelligent coding companion. Built with modern development workflows in mind, it combines intuitive command suggestions, interactive guidance, and smart automation to streamline your development process. Some key features include:

  • Interactive Tutorials: Built-in guides for common development tasks
  • Project Templates: Quick scaffolding for various project types
  • Custom Workflow Automation: Create and share your automated task sequences
